The MAX1507/MAX1508 evaluation kit (EV kit) is a complete,
fully assembled, and tested circuit board that
demonstrates the MAX1507 linear battery charger for a
single-cell lithium-ion (Li+) battery. To evaluate the
MAX1508, U1 must be removed and replaced with a
MAX1508 device. The EV kit safely charges a single Li+
battery to 4.2V. The EV kit accepts a power-supply
input of 4.25V to 13V, but disables charging when the
input voltage exceeds 7V. Jumpers on the EV kit allow
adjustments to the die-temperature regulation levels
(MAX1507 only) and the ability to disable the charger.
An LED on the board indicates the status of the charging
cycle.
Key Features
Applications/Uses
Simple, Stand-Alone Li+ Charger
Safely Precharges Deeply Discharged Li+ Cells
4.25V to 13V Input Voltage Range
7V Overvoltage Protection Threshold
Resistor-Programmable Charge Current Up
to 0.8A
Charge Current Monitored by a Resistor
Programmable Die-Temperature Regulation Set
Points (MAX1507 Only)
